Pricing Plans & Free Trials - Which Tool Provides The Highest & Quickest ROI?
Instantly's pricing model offers multiple product lines (Outreach, SuperSearch and CRM) with plans scaled for outreach volume and credits (+ a free trial and discounted annual billing), but for this comparison we'll focus on the Outreach pricing.
$47/mo for Growth plan (you get: unlimited email accounts, unlimited email warmup, 1,000 uploaded contacts, 5,000 emails/month, chat support)
$97/mo for Hypergrowth plan (you get: unlimited email accounts, unlimited warmup, 25,000 uploaded contacts, 100,000 emails/month, premium live support and team features)
$358/mo for Light Speed plan (you get: everything in Hypergrowth, 100,000 uploaded contacts, 500,000 emails/month, and the SISR (Server & IP Sharding & Rotation) deliverability system)
Snov offers a variety of different paid plans depending on your desired outreach scale (as well as a 5% discount on quarterly billing, and 25% discount on annual billing):
$39/mo for Starter plan (you get: 1000 credits, 5000 recipients, 3 warm-ups, unlimited mailbox slots, unlimited campaigns, some basic email deliverability and sales management capabilities, prospect/company search, access to webhooks, API, HubSpot, Pipedrive, Zapier, Make, and Calendly integrations)
$99/mo - $738/mo for Pro plan (you get: 5000 - 100000 credits, 25000 - 200000 recipients, unlimited mailbox warm-ups, unlimited mailbox slots, everything from Starter plan + reply analysis, A/B testing, dynamic personalization and spintax, campaign priority/volume control, follow-up priority option, prospect list sharing with team, more teamwork features, priority support)
Custom pricing for Ultra Custom Plan (contact sales to negotiate price and scale)
Each LinkedIn automation slot costs an additional $69/mo.
Salesforge provides 2 plans oriented around outreach scale and a 14-day free trial (with 2 free months granted when billed annually):
$48/mo for Pro plan (you get: 1000 active contacts in sequence, 5000 messages/mo, 100 email validation credits/mo, 100 personalization credits/mo, unlimited mailboxes, unlimited contact storage, free premium warm up via Warmforge, unlimited workspaces, connect unlimited mailboxes, a unified inbox (Primebox), mailbox rotation, dynamic IPs, live chat support and more)
$96/mo for Growth plan (you get: 10x the credits from the Pro plan, unlimited seats, A/B testing, personal onboarding, API access, 100 social action credits/month, multi-language sequences, Primebox AI reply crafting, ESP matching, access to a massive knowledge base and more)

Multi-Channel Outreach: Cold Email Campaigns vs LinkedIn Campaigns
It's hard to over-emphasize the importance of multi-channel outreach in today's cold outreach landscape.
Salesforge supports email + LinkedIn sequences natively. It also offers unlimited LinkedIn senders, unlimited mailboxes, unlimited seats, and even unlimited shared workspaces. Salesforge's unified reply inbox (Primebox) made it incredibly easy for me to keep a single workflow across both channels, with the additional perk of adding AI touches to streamline the process further.
Instantly, on the other hand, is email-first. You can integrate LinkedIn via 3rd party integrations, but you’ll often have to deal with various struggles, such as managing replies separately.
Snov sits somewhere in the middle here. It does support some basic multi-step sequences that mix LinkedIn actions and email, but the $69/mo additional cost for every LinkedIn sender is definitely a hefty price tag. If LinkedIn is necessary in your sequences - Snov gets you there, but Salesforge feels more like the platform built around that motion from the start.
